Walkable, bike-friendly places to live Surrey?

1 reply

Olivane · 13/04/2024 22:58

We're London renters in our mid 30s (no kids) looking to buy a house in Surrey area, but feeling overwhelmed by the vast London commuter belt where all towns that are affordable seem samey (and a bit dull?). Our budget is about £600k and we're looking for 3 bedrooms, but flexible. Have been looking at Dorking and surrounding villages as we like Surrey Hills/Box Hill and need train links for commuting to London a few days a week. DP's family all live in Sussex and Surrey and he'd like to stay within an hour or so of them. (My family mostly live deep in Scotland, so I'm not fussed).

We mainly want to live somewhere walkable with cycling links, and sociable - where we can easily pop to some shops/pubs/cafe, and have access to a decent park/countryside walks. Somewhere with things to do and a bit of a community would be a bonus too. Where would you all recommend looking?

Have a look at Horsham - not Surrey but train service is great as you can go to either Victoria or the City. I found it had mote character than a lot of the typical commuter towns and provided you live in the centre you can walk to countryside/shops/station/cafes. There’s a market a couple of days per week, too.
